  5. Quick Update: I just received a call from the dealership and they said that it is indeed a faulty 'PTU' and it has to be replaced. Unfortunately, they do not have any in stock and have to order the part in. Seeing that I was a bit of a bear this morning when dropping the truck off (having the new truck for only 3 weeks and all and with only 2,000 km on it I guess you understand why I was a little miffed), they are having the part rushed in and it will be here on Monday, so I will get the new PTU put on the Edge then. I'm praying to God that this fixes the problem(s) I've been having over the past week and a half. I guess I'll fine out next week. Oh ya... the dealership called the Ford headoffice to ask if it is safe to drive the vehicle with a faulty PTU and they apparently said, "yes...100% safe until you get the part in". I made sure to ask this because I did not want to mess up my warranty in anyway. I got them to note this comment on the invoice. Hi, I just bought a new 2010 Ford Edge a few weeks ago and have only 2,000 km on it and over the past week or so, I've been noticing that when I start to accelerate I hear a "clunk" or knocking noise. It happens right around 10 - 20 km/ph when the vehicle is shifting from 1st to 2nd gear. It doesn't happen from 3 gear on, and it doesn't seem to happen every time I'm driving the vehicle. I've read a number of posting of the dreaded "PTU" and tranny seal leaks and hoping that this isn't the issue. I plan on bringing it into the dealer, but I was just curious if anyone else has experienced this type of behaviour / noise coming from their Edge and if so...what was the issue?
